UW Health Rehabilitation Hospital - Madison is seeking an Outcomes Manager to coordinate IRF-PAI data collection and QI documentation in alignment with CMS requirements. You will partner with the interdisciplinary team to ensure timely, accurate data capture and education on documentation standards.
The role emphasizes attending to admission/discharge IRF-PAI timelines and maintaining data integrity in CMS-supported systems, contributing to high-quality patient care and regulatory compliance.

An Outcomes Manager who excels in this role coordinates collection, documentation, and submission of Inpatient Rehabilitation Facility Patient Assessment Instrument (IRF-PAI) and Quality Indicators (QIs) data in accordance with CMS requirements and facility policies. Partners with the interdisciplinary team to ensure timely, accurate data capture and supports education on QI documentation standards.
Works closely with nursing, therapy, case management, and medical staff to support accurate QI scoring and IRF-PAI completion. Adheres to CMS regulations, payer guidelines, and organizational policies related to data integrity and timeliness. May assist with audits, performance improvement activities, and data validation.
Education: Clinical degree with current license to practice as an OT, PT, RN, SLP, or MSW.
Knowledge: QI competency; working knowledge of state and federal guidelines; familiarity with healthcare workflows and documentation.
Skills: Basic computer and data entry proficiency; strong clinical assessment/analysis; effective verbal and written communication; excellent interpersonal skills; ability to collaborate across disciplines and meet strict deadlines with high accuracy.
